Generated by GPT-5-mini| Elbrus (computer) | |
|---|---|
![]() МЦСТ / MCST · Public domain · source | |
| Name | Elbrus |
| Developer | Soviet Union; Soviet Ministry of Instrument Making; Institute of Precision Mechanics and Computer Engineering |
| Family | Elbrus series |
| Released | 1979 (original), 1990s (revivals) |
| Discontinued | 2000s (original line) |
| Cpu | VLIW, EPIC variations |
| Memory | magnetic core, semiconductor RAM |
| Os | Ельбрус-1OS; Batch processing systems; Linux |
| Display | vector terminals; raster workstations |
Elbrus (computer) is a series of Soviet and Russian high-performance computing systems originating from designs by Boris Babayan and teams at the Institute of Precision Mechanics and Computer Engineering and later developed by enterprises linked to the Soviet Ministry of Instrument Making and Moscow Center of SPARC development. The project produced multiple generations integrating research from Soviet Academy of Sciences, adopting very long instruction word (VLIW) concepts and later explicitly parallel instruction computing techniques, influencing computing for Roscosmos projects, Russian Armed Forces command systems, and national cryptographic efforts. The lineage includes hardware, compilers, and operating environments that interfaced with standards and toolchains used by Intel and ARM ecosystems.
Development began under directives from the Soviet Council of Ministers in the 1970s with leadership from Boris Babayan, motivated by strategic needs similar to those addressed by the Cray Research supercomputers and the CDC 6600. Early prototypes drew upon microprogramming traditions seen in designs by John von Neumann-era projects and contemporaneous work at IBM research labs. The first-generation systems emerged in the late 1970s and early 1980s, coinciding with procurement debates involving Ministry of Defense requirements and collaboration with institutes such as the Lebedev Physical Institute. In the 1990s, after the dissolution of the Soviet Union, entities like Moscow Center of SPARC development and companies spun out from state enterprises resurrected the line to address needs at Rosatom, Roscosmos, and national research centers, adapting to interoperability with GNU Project toolchains and commodity hardware.
Elbrus architecture centered on wide-instruction philosophies akin to VLIW and later EPIC approaches found in Hewlett-Packard and Intel research. Microarchitecture incorporated explicit instruction scheduling, register stacking, and predication techniques reminiscent of innovations by Alan Turing-era theorists and later hardware found in Transmeta designs. The instruction set and pipeline optimizations addressed floating-point throughput demanded by scientific projects similar to workloads at Moscow State University and Institute for High Energy Physics. Hardware-assisted multiprocessing, cache coherency protocols inspired by research at Massachusetts Institute of Technology and Bell Labs, and peripheral interfacing compatible with standards promoted by IEEE guided system integration. Design reviews referenced implementations from Burroughs Corporation and compiler strategies advocated by figures such as John Backus.
Implementations ranged from rack-mounted processors using early semiconductor RAM and core memory technologies to chip-level reworks employing CMOS fabrication methods influenced by fabs associated with Mikron and collaborations with institutes like Moscow State Technical University. Later nodes integrated CMOS ASICs, field-programmable logic similar to products from Xilinx and Altera, and memory hierarchies paralleling innovations at Sun Microsystems and DEC. Peripherals and I/O subsystems interfaced with terminals inspired by DEC VT100 and storage subsystems echoing designs from Seagate Technology-era architectures. Systems were manufactured by state-run enterprises that later became corporations interacting with vendors such as Intel for interoperability testing.
Software ecosystems included compilers and toolchains supporting VLIW scheduling comparable to efforts within the GNU Project and compiler research at Bell Labs and University of Cambridge Computer Laboratory. Operating environments ranged from batch-oriented systems used in scientific centers to multitasking kernels adapted from research influenced by Unix and academic systems from Stanford University. High-level language support encompassed languages analogous to Fortran, ALGOL, and later C/C++, with front ends adapted to exploit predication and parallelism similar to optimizing compilers developed at Carnegie Mellon University and Princeton University. Porting efforts connected Elbrus systems to network protocols influenced by ARPANET and standards from International Organization for Standardization.
Benchmarks for Elbrus installations were reported in Soviet-era journals and compared with contemporaries such as machines from Cray Research and workstations from Silicon Graphics. Performance evaluation used floating-point tests akin to LINPACK-style workloads and vectorized routines similar to those optimized for Intel x86 and SPARC architectures. Later generations showed improvements attributable to pipeline parallelism and compiler scheduling techniques paralleling gains documented in studies at University of California, Berkeley and ETH Zurich. Comparative metrics influenced procurement decisions at research organizations including Joint Institute for Nuclear Research and industrial labs at GosNIIAS.
Elbrus systems served in command and control installations for the Soviet Armed Forces, scientific computation at facilities like Kurchatov Institute, and industrial control in enterprises analogous to Gazprom and Rosatom projects. Academic curricula at institutions such as Moscow Institute of Physics and Technology incorporated study of Elbrus architecture alongside curricula referencing Computer History Museum archives and international processor research. Legacy aspects include influence on Russian microprocessor programs, inspiration for VLIW/EPIC research in academic groups at Moscow State University and spin-off vendors that engaged with global suppliers like Intel and ARM Holdings. Remnants of the platform persist in specialized systems used for aerospace telemetry at TsNIIMASH and in preservation efforts by computing museums and heritage projects in Moscow.